Construction and properties – the key to long-term operation
The wire is made of multi-strand copper core class 5, which guarantees high flexibility and resistance to material fatigue during frequent bending. Silicone insulation provides resistance to high temperatures (up to +180°C in stationary operation and flexibly up to +180°C) and aggressive chemicals – oils, greases, acids and alkalis. The rated voltage is 500 V, and the test voltage is 2000 V, which confirms its safety of use. The outer diameter of the wire is approximately 2.3 mm.
- Core made of class 5 stranded copper ensures flexibility and connection durability.
- Silicone insulation guarantees resistance to high temperatures and chemicals.
- Rated voltage of 500 V enables safe operation in electrical installations.
- The wire is chemically resistant to oils, greases, acids, alkalis and other aggressive substances.
- Operating temperature range is from -25°C to +180°C (flexible) and from -60°C to +180°C (stationary) – enables a wide range of applications.
Applications – where will this wire work?
Silicone wire SiF is particularly recommended for applications in industries: steel, metallurgical, aviation, shipbuilding, cement and ceramic. The halogen-free construction also allows it to be used in power plants. Thanks to its flexibility and resistance to high temperatures, it is ideal for connecting moving parts of machines and heating devices. It will also work wherever high resistance to weather and chemical conditions is required. The minimum bending radius is 15x the wire diameter in flexible operation and 6x in fixed installation, which facilitates assembly even in tight spaces.
